BT面板迁移教程方法,轻松实现服务器环境无缝转移

    发布时间:2026-01-16 02:40 更新时间:2025-12-07 02:36 阅读量:7

    对于众多站长和运维人员而言,宝塔面板(BT Panel)凭借其直观的可视化操作,极大地简化了服务器环境的管理工作。然而,当服务器需要升级、更换服务商或进行数据整合时,如何将原有的宝塔面板环境完整、平滑地迁移到新服务器,就成为一个关键且常见的需求。本文将为您详细解析几种主流的BT面板迁移方法,助您高效、安全地完成迁移任务。

    一、迁移前的核心准备工作

    无论采用何种迁移方法,充分的准备工作是成功迁移的基石。请务必在操作前完成以下步骤:

    1. 全面备份:这是迁移操作的“生命线”。您需要在原服务器上,通过宝塔面板的“计划任务”功能,对网站文件、数据库、站点配置进行完整备份。同时,建议通过FTP或SSH手动下载备份文件至本地,实现双重保险。
    2. 环境勘察:记录原服务器的关键环境信息,包括但不限于PHP版本、MySQL/MariaDB版本、已安装的扩展、伪静态规则、SSL证书信息以及面板设置等。确保新服务器能预先搭建相同或兼容的运行环境。
    3. 新服务器初始化:在新服务器上安装与旧服务器版本相同或更新的宝塔面板。建议选择相同的操作系统(如CentOS 7.x/8.x或Ubuntu 20.04 LTS),以最大程度避免环境兼容性问题。

    二、主流迁移方法详解

    方法一:利用宝塔官方“一键迁移”插件(推荐)

    这是宝塔官方提供的自动化迁移工具,适用于同版本面板间的迁移,操作简便,成功率较高。

    • 操作流程
    1. 在原服务器与新服务器的宝塔面板中,分别安装 “宝塔一键迁移API版本” 插件。
    2. 原服务器的迁移插件中生成迁移密钥。
    3. 新服务器的迁移插件中,填写原服务器的IP、迁移密钥及端口,进行连接验证。
    4. 选择需要迁移的站点、数据库及FTP账号,提交迁移任务。
    5. 插件将自动完成数据打包、传输、解压和配置恢复。
    • 优势与注意事项
    • 优势:自动化程度高,能同步迁移站点配置、数据库、FTP等,减少手动操作。
    • 注意:要求两台服务器面板版本尽量一致;迁移过程中,原站点最好暂停访问,以保证数据一致性;大文件迁移耗时较长,需保持网络稳定。

    方法二:手动备份与恢复(通用可靠)

    这是一种更为基础且通用的方法,适用于所有场景,尤其是面板版本不同或服务器环境有差异的情况。其核心思想是 “文件+数据库+配置”的分步迁移

    • 操作流程
    1. 文件迁移:通过宝塔面板备份或直接使用压缩命令(如 tar -zcvf),将wwwroot目录下的所有网站文件打包。然后通过SCP、Rsync或FTP工具,将压缩包传输到新服务器的对应目录并解压。
    2. 数据库迁移:在宝塔面板的数据库管理中,导出每个站点对应的数据库为SQL文件。在新服务器上创建同名数据库和用户,并将SQL文件导入。
    3. 站点配置重建:在新服务器宝塔面板中,“添加站点”,将域名指向已迁移的网站文件目录。随后,需手动重新配置:
    • 伪静态规则:从旧服务器配置文件(如Nginx的conf文件)中复制。
    • SSL证书:重新申请或上传原有证书文件。
    • PHP版本:为站点选择与原环境一致的PHP版本。
    1. 检查与调试:修改本地hosts文件,将域名临时解析到新服务器IP,测试网站访问、数据库连接及各项功能是否正常。
    • 优势与注意事项
    • 优势:可控性强,能清晰了解每一步的迁移状态,适用于复杂环境。
    • 注意:此方法要求操作者对服务器和宝塔面板有一定了解;需特别注意文件权限(通常保持为www:www或755/644)和配置文件路径的准确性。

    方法三:整机镜像或快照迁移(适用于云服务器)

    如果您使用的是阿里云、腾讯云等云服务商,可以利用其提供的系统盘镜像或快照功能进行整机迁移。

    • 操作流程
    1. 在原服务器上创建系统盘快照或自定义镜像。
    2. 使用该镜像在新区域或新账号下创建一台新的云服务器实例。
    3. 启动新服务器后,宝塔面板及所有环境、数据将与原服务器完全一致。
    • 优势与注意事项
    • 优势:迁移最彻底,环境零差异,操作相对简单。
    • 注意:此方法迁移的是整个系统盘,新服务器的IP地址会改变,因此迁移后必须及时在DNS服务商处更新域名解析记录。同时,可能涉及云服务商之间的镜像格式兼容性问题。

    三、迁移后的关键验证步骤

    迁移操作完成后,切勿立即删除原服务器数据。请务必进行严格验证:

    1. DNS解析切换:在确认新站点完全测试无误后,再将域名的DNS解析记录(A记录)从原服务器IP修改为新服务器IP。注意TTL值及全球生效时间。
    2. 全面功能测试:重点测试网站前台访问、后台登录、表单提交、数据库读写、图片上传、支付回调等动态功能。
    3. 性能与安全复查:检查新服务器防火墙、宝塔面板安全设置是否已正确配置,并观察网站运行性能是否正常。

    总结而言,BT面板迁移的核心在于“准备充分、方法得当、验证严谨”。对于大多数用户,推荐优先尝试官方“一键迁移”插件,若遇环境兼容问题,则采用手动备份恢复法作为可靠备选。而云服务器用户,则可评估整机镜像迁移的效率优势。掌握这些方法,您将能从容应对各种服务器迁移场景,确保业务平稳过渡。

    继续阅读

    📑 📅
    宝塔运维面板,网站部署难题的快速解决方案 2026-01-16
    宝塔面板故障排查方法,从入门到精通的系统指南 2026-01-16
    宝塔面板网站部署最佳实践,高效、安全与稳定之道 2026-01-16
    宝塔Linux面板PHP优化指南,释放网站性能的实战策略 2026-01-16
    宝塔服务器面板优化,快速解决性能与安全难题 2026-01-16
    宝塔运维面板安装排查,从失败到成功的完整指南 2026-01-16
    BT面板MySQL优化教程,提升数据库性能的完整指南 2026-01-16
    宝塔Linux面板升级失败案例,深度剖析与解决方案 2026-01-16
    宝塔Linux面板故障排查案例,从入门到精通的实战指南 2026-01-16
    宝塔面板SSL配置图文教程,轻松为你的网站开启HTTPS加密 2026-01-16